But Shenmu is not without its challenges. The weather can be unpredictable, shifting from bright sunshine to torrential downpours in a matter of minutes. Navigating the trails requires careful attention to detail, especially in less-maintained areas. And while the solitude is often a welcome escape from the stresses of modern life, it's crucial to be prepared for emergencies and to hike with a companion, or at least inform someone of your planned route and expected return time.

For those planning a Shenmu hiking adventure, careful preparation is essential. Appropriate footwear is paramount, as are layers of clothing to adapt to changing weather conditions. A high-quality backpack, capable of carrying all necessary supplies, is also a must. Navigation tools, such as a map and compass, or a GPS device, are indispensable, especially when venturing off established trails. And most importantly, a healthy respect for the environment and a commitment to leave no trace are crucial for preserving the beauty and integrity of this remarkable wilderness area.
